What is an assessment of mental health?

A mental health assessment or psychometric assessment, is an in-depth look at your emotional state, as well as how you think, remember, and reason (cognitive function). It involves an interview with a doctor, and sometimes with a third party, and often includes tests in the lab. You'll be asked to answer questions both verbally and in writing. The doctors are looking for information on how you feel, the nature of your problems, and if you have a family history of mental illness. They'll take notes and do physical examinations, too.

A psychiatric examination is the initial step in treating mental illness, but it may also be required for other reasons. It can be ordered by a court, probation office, or child protection agency who wants to be sure that they looked at all the available information about you before making a decision. It could also be requested by a patient who believes that they have mental illness and would like to begin treatment as soon as possible.

The psychiatric evaluation starts with a discussion of your symptoms and what they're like, what's been happening in your life lately and what you've attempted to do to alleviate these symptoms. You'll likely be asked regarding your family and relationships with them. Additionally, if mental health test have children, the doctors will ask about their school performance and how they behave at home. The therapist will then look over you and do tests on your blood to determine the cause of your symptoms.

Another important part of the psychotherapy assessment is the mental status examination, which is a way for a doctor to assess your current state of mind and how you're doing. The MSE includes a description of your appearance and behaviour as well as your level of consciousness and attentiveness speech, motor activity mood and affect thoughts, the content of your thoughts, perception, insight, and judgment.

What is a psycho-psychiatric assessment?

A psychiatric examination is used to diagnose developmental, emotional or behavioral disorders. It can be conducted on a child or adolescent. During a psychiatric assessment psychiatrist will analyze the person's behavior and how it might be related to their medical history as well as their genetics. They also look at the effects of social, environmental, and cognitive (thinking factors).

The psychiatrist will ask the patient to describe their symptoms, what they are, when they started and how often they occur. They will also ask about any major life events and how they affected the person. They will also ask about family history to determine if there is a family history of mental health issues.

In a psychiatric examination the doctor will note the patient's appearance, mood, and behavior. They will also ask the patient about their day-to-day activities and how they manage their symptoms. The doctor will then look over the results and then make the diagnosis.

How is a psychiatric evaluation conducted?


A psychiatric evaluation is a process that can be conducted by a psychiatrist or other mental health professional. The evaluator asks questions about the symptoms and thoughts of the individual to determine what's happening and the best method to treat it. The evaluator can also inquire about the person's past medical background, family history and any recent abuse or trauma. They may also inquire about the person about their coping methods and ways they manage their symptoms. The evaluator may also inquire about their beliefs, opinions and values. The evaluator may also examine the person for symptoms of anxiety, depression or other mental health disorders. They will look at the person's facial expressions eyes, body movements, and facial language to determine their mental state.

The evaluator will request tests in the lab based on the health of the individual to understand what's happening in the brain. They will also do a physical exam to make sure there are no medical problems that could be causing the person's symptoms.

The evaluator then compares patient's behavior and symptoms to diagnoses of various mental illnesses. The evaluator will then discuss the treatment options available to the patient. Treatment typically consists of a combination of medication and psychotherapy. The evaluator may also give a patient an idea of the prognosis. This is the chance of recovery.
